Trading Doesn't Require a Big Bankroll

One of the most persistent myths in forex trading is that you need thousands of dollars to get started. A decade ago, that might have been true — many brokers required $500 or $1,000 minimum deposits, and micro lots weren't widely available. Today, the landscape has shifted dramatically. Several well-regulated brokers let you open a live account with $10, $5, or even $0.

This isn't a compromise on quality. Brokers like Pepperstone, which has no minimum deposit requirement, offer the same raw spread accounts and institutional-grade execution to a $50 account as they do to a $50,000 account. The democratization of trading access means your starting capital is no longer a barrier to entry — your knowledge and discipline are.

Why Brokers Offer Low Minimum Deposits

It's a reasonable question: why would a broker let you deposit just $5? The answer is straightforward — they make money from spreads and commissions, not your deposit size. A trader who deposits $100 and makes 10 trades per day generates more revenue than someone who deposits $10,000 and trades once a month. Low minimums are a customer acquisition strategy, not a charity program.

The smarter brokers also understand that today's $100 depositor might become tomorrow's $10,000 trader. By removing the barrier to entry, they build a relationship early. This model works well for both sides — you get to test a broker with real money without significant risk, and they get a chance to prove their service quality.

Low Deposit vs. Low Quality: Know the Difference

Not all low-deposit brokers are created equal. Some offshore brokers use $1 minimums as bait, pairing them with poor execution, wide spreads, and weak regulation. The brokers on this page all hold at least one tier-1 license (FCA, ASIC, CySEC) and scored well across our full testing criteria — execution speed, spread consistency, platform reliability, and withdrawal processing.

We specifically tested the small-account experience at each broker. Some brokers technically allow $5 deposits but then restrict you to a basic platform or wider spreads. The brokers listed here provide the same trading conditions regardless of your deposit size. A $10 account gets the same spreads, the same platforms, and the same customer support as a $10,000 account.

Realistic Expectations with a Small Account

While you can start with $5, let's be honest about what's realistic. With a $5 account trading micro lots (0.01), a 100-pip move in your favor makes you $1. That's not going to replace your income. But that's not the point. A small account lets you experience real market conditions — the psychology of watching real money move, the discipline of following a plan when your balance fluctuates. This education is worth far more than the $50-$100 you deposit.

The practical sweet spot for a starter account is $100-$500. This gives you enough margin to trade micro lots across multiple pairs, set reasonable stop-losses without being stopped out by normal market noise, and treat trading as a serious learning exercise rather than a gamble.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I really start trading with just $1?

Yes. Several brokers including Exness and FBS accept deposits as low as $1. However, with such a small amount, you'll be limited to micro lots and may struggle with proper risk management. Starting with $50-$100 gives you more realistic trading conditions.

Are low minimum deposit brokers safe?

Many are. Brokers like XM ($5 minimum), Pepperstone ($0 minimum), and IC Markets ($200 but often waived) are regulated by top-tier authorities. The key is checking regulation, not deposit requirements. A low minimum doesn't mean low quality.

What's the catch with $0 minimum deposit brokers?

There's usually no catch — brokers like Pepperstone and eToro use this as a marketing strategy to attract new traders. They make money from spreads and commissions regardless of your deposit size. Just check that spreads and fees are competitive.

Should beginners start with a small deposit?

Starting small is smart for learning. Deposit $50-$200, trade micro lots, and focus on developing a consistent strategy. Once profitable on a small account, you can add more capital. This approach limits your risk while you build experience.
